In the bug I posted, the namelist-group-name is local to the main
program, not accessed by use association. It's a namelist-group-object,
which 8.9 "Namelist Statement" p5 (F18, and F25 draft) explicitly says
can be accessed by use association, that apparently can't be renamed
and then the local name used in a namelist statement.
